This text demonstrates a prime knot, specifically 7_2, tied and tightened within a constant-radius tube. The thin version has reduced tube size to enhance visibility of crossings, while the thick version displays full-scale tubing. These models are easier to print with minimal support material. For more information about the 7_2 prime knot, visit its Knot Atlas page at http://katlas.math.toronto.edu/wiki/7_2. This unique shape is created by RidgeRunner, a free software available at http://www.jasoncantarella.com/wordpress/software/ridgerunner/, which minimizes the knot's length while preserving a tube around it. Different functions can be optimized to yield varied knot shapes. To witness this prime knot tightening, view the movie at http://www.jasoncantarella.com/movs.
